Camping near Rosedale

Within reach of Rosedale, 50 campgrounds across 7 parks appear on Recreation.gov: 30 at Great Smoky Mountains, 5 at Mammoth Cave, 5 at Indiana Dunes, and 5 at New River Gorge, plus 3 more parks with fewer sites.

Recreation.gov releases most national park campsites six months before the arrival date, at 10:00 a.m. Eastern time. Windows are set per campground, so confirm yours on the Seasons and Fees tab on that campground page.

Once a date is gone, cancellations are the real supply, and they get taken within minutes of appearing.

When to make this trip

Hot Springs National Park is generally best March through May, then September through November, with February and December as the quieter shoulder either side.

Midsummer is hot, humid, and buggy; winter is mild and one of the better times to visit.

Biting insects and afternoon storms dominate summer. Repellent and a rain shell matter more than warm layers.

Planning a trip from Rosedale

Distances here are straight-line and the drive estimate adds a road factor on top, but mountain passes and seasonal closures can change it a lot — a route that looks like three hours in June can be shut entirely in February. Confirm road status with the park before you commit to a date.
